French doors add elegance to any house. They are hinged, which is different from sliding doors. This means that they require more space than swinging doors to fully open.
The cost to replace sliding doors with french doors may differ depending on the kind of French door selected and cost of installation. Here are some general guidelines that will aid you in budgeting your project.
Cost to take down the door
Many homeowners would like to replace sliding doors with French doors. However, the cost to replace sliding doors with French doors can be costly. This is because the old door needs to be removed and a new frame must be added. It could be necessary to make the frame stronger to be able to support the weightier French door. Additionally, it may be necessary to relocate furniture so that the new door can be opened and closed without blocking the path.
The cost of replacing sliding doors with French Doors varies based on the type of door you choose and the options you decide to make. If you decide to add sidelights on your French doors, the cost will increase. This is because the doors need to be cut to the proper size.
You can also opt to include window grilles on your French doors. These add a classic look that fits well in many traditional style homes. They can also help you reduce your energy costs by improving the insulation in your home. If you're seeking a more contemporary style, you can opt for Low-E glass. This is a specific coating that improves the insulating properties of windows.
If you choose to install your French doors professionally installed, the cost will be more expensive than if you install it yourself. An expert installer will charge between $300 and $850 for labor. This is in addition to the cost of your doors as well as any additional features you select. If you're planning to complete the installation yourself, the price will be lower but you'll need to purchase or rent the tools needed to complete the task.
It will give your home a more attractive appearance and may even increase the value. Furthermore, it can make your house easier to maintain. Moreover, French doors offer more light and ventilation than sliding doors.
Cost to Install a New Door
Many people choose to replace sliding patio doors with French Doors because they add an elegant look to a home. They also offer more privacy than a sliding door since they don't open as wide. French doors are more energy efficient if they have double-glazed windows.
The cost of the cost of a French door will vary depending on the design and the material. For example a solid-core door will cost more than an interior laminated glass panel. French doors with a more durable frame are more expensive than those with a fiberglass frame. It is essential to compare quotes from a variety of contractors to ensure that you get the best price for your new French door.
To install a new French door, you'll have to take down the old sliding door and then make the opening ready for the new door. This may require some framing work, so make sure you hire a professional do the job. After the frame is installed, you are able to hang your doors and install other hardware. It's important to follow the instructions of the manufacturer and do a thorough job of measuring so your doors are positioned correctly.
French doors are more durable than sliding patio doors however, they require maintenance and repair. It is possible to repair your locks, handles, or hinges, which could be costly. In addition, you may need to replace glass pane in french door or repair your weather stripping to avoid leaks. It is also necessary to maintain your French doors by regularly cleaning the frames and washing the glass.

Cost of installing Hardware
The hardware will need to be replaced when replacing sliding doors with French Doors. This includes the hinges, door handle, and lock. The cost of installing this hardware depends on the type and the quality of the hardware as well as the cost of labor. Homeowners can expect to pay an average of $100 to $250 for this portion of the project. Homeowners have to include this component of the project in their cost estimate. If they don't include it, then the project will cost more than they anticipated.
A professional can provide you with a free estimate of the cost of replacing sliding doors with french door locking mechanism replacement Doors. They will be able to provide you with a detailed breakdown of all the costs involved in this project, including removal and removal of the old doors, as well as labor costs for installing the new ones, as well as any other charges that might be applicable.
Homeowners should also consider the cost of buying and installing any additional hardware that they might want to include to their French doors. You can also add window grills to give your doors a more classic look. Other options for hardware that can be fitted on French doors are door locks, which could assist in keeping unwanted guests out of the home.
Another factor to consider is the cost of re-caulking the frames of the French doors that will be required after the replacement is completed. It can cost between $30 and $50, depending on the dimensions. This is an essential step to ensure that your French doors will be weatherproof for many years.
